Lot 025: 1991 MERCEDES-BENZ 300 CE

Introduced in 1986, the Mercedes-Benz E-Class (W124) is still renowned for its engineering integrity and superb build quality. A monocoque chassis design equipped with beautifully balanced coil-sprung suspension (wishbone front / multi-link rear), nicely weighted power-assisted steering and responsive four-wheel disc brakes, it was propelled by a generous selection of petrol and diesel engines. Available in saloon, estate, coupe and convertible guises, the vast majority were specified with automatic transmission. An early flagship for the range, the 300CE exhibited notably sure-footed handling thanks to its forward-biased 53:47 weight distribution. Credited with 177bhp and 188lbft of torque, its 2962cc SOHC straight-six powerplant reputedly enabled the pillarless four-seater to accelerate from 0-60mph in 8.5 seconds and onto 137mph. Belying its performance potential, the two-door coupe was blessed with elegant yet understated styling and a cosseting interior. Finished in silver with beige leather upholstery, this particular example is described by the vendor as "a very original car". Reportedly retaining its factory-fitted 'flat face' alloy wheels, 'J729 PBT' is also understood to benefit from a Clifford alarm, Kenwood 'face off' stereo, cruise control, heated seats, sunroof and air conditioning. Said to drive "superbly" and to boast "fifteen stamps in its service book", the coupe has apparently had "just three registered owners". Believed but not warranted to have covered 120,560 miles from new, this "very well specified" 300CE is offered for sale with the aforementioned service book and MOT certificate valid until November 2007.
